Pichia Protocols focuses on recent developments of Pichia
pastoris as a recombinant protein production system. Highlighted
topics include a discussion on the use of fermentors to grow Pichia
pastoris, information on the O- and N-linked glycosylation, methods
for labeling Pichia pastoris expressed proteins for structural
studies, and the introduction of mutations in Pichia pastoris genes
by the methods of restriction enzyme-mediated integration
(REMI).
This volume fully updates and expands upon the first edition of
Pichia Protocols, and focuses primarily on information that has
come to light since its original publication. Each chapter presents
cutting-edge and cornerstone protocols for utilizing P. pastoris as
a model recomibinant protein production system.
